Introduction

  • Sampling of gases (high pressure, acid gas & liquid Sulphur etc.) from Mesaieed Operation facilities / stations.
  • Carrying out physical and chemical tests on finished products or at intermediate stage and incoming feed streams, also on chemicals (DIPA, MDEA, etc.) used in the process.
  • Adhering to international standard methods like ASTM, UOP, IP, SMS, HACH, LOVIBOND, SNEA, etc.

What are you going to do 

  • Collecting samples using proper sampling techniques and observing safety procedures, wearing B.A. set if the situation demands it. Sampling of high- pressure liquids, acid gas, Sulphur, C2 rich gases, should be done with the help of the Operator.
  • Should notify Shift Foreman if anything wrong with the existing sampling point so that it can be modified or rectified. Similarly, the bombs in use also should be under observation for any leakage or damaged valves and should be reported to the Shift Foreman.
  • Disposal of samples should be done using proper safety precautions, i.e., gloves, safety goggles, face shields and safety shoes.
  • Analyzing hydrocarbons in gas or liquid, liquefied gas products like C3, C4 and Condensate streams at various process stages – incoming feed, intermediate stage or finished product. Carries out analysis on LPG shipments, NGL condensate, NF condensate and Arab-‘D’ condensate shipment with the assistance and supervision of the Shift Foreman Involves sample collection / analysis with bombs, flasks, gas scrubbers, titration apparatus, MV meter, distillation unit, valve freeze unit, Lab X- 3500, Tracor Atlas and GC. Tests involving strong smelling hydrocarbons and escaping toxic gases, should be carried out in fume cabinet only.
  • Analysis of acid gas and tail gas should be done along with another Lab Technician
    • never alone, as it involves high concentration of H2S (45%) and CO2 (55%).
  • Analysis of sample of chemicals used during the treatment steps of LPG streams or offshore feed streams, Kontol, Servo, DIPA (lean, rich, tank), MDEA (lean, rich, tank) and Glycol by using various instruments i.e. Metrohm titroprocessors, PH meter, spectrophotometer, titration apparatus, KF, and GC etc.
  • Analyses utility samples from desalination plant, boiler, and boiler-feed water samples lube oil, seal oil samples, instrument air compressor. Equipment used are Lovibond comparator, PH conductivity meter, hydrometer, Metrohm 702 titrino, viscometers, Shaw moisture meter, Hach & spectrophotometer.
